Output fec1524338832d927c05459bc53b8d57be1c839390f8d08982cbf98e6c201321:3

value
8280880
script pubkey
OP_0 OP_PUSHBYTES_20 8c6d43199b1e26b86bc46a0a0f4f20fa4b48e7e6
address
bc1q33k5xxvmrcnts67ydg9q7neqlf953elxm6zy3t
transaction
fec1524338832d927c05459bc53b8d57be1c839390f8d08982cbf98e6c201321
confirmations
89257
spent
true